编号 题目 状态 分数 总时间 内存 代码 / 答案文件 提交者 提交时间
#6518 #1081. Luke's Game Time Limit Exceeded 30 7216 ms 400 K C++ 17 (Clang) / 603 B t330026189 2024-11-16 15:47:26
显示原始代码
#include <bits/stdc++.h>
using namespace std;

#define int long long

#define il inline

#define rd read()


const int inf = 1e9 + 100;
int n;

il int read() {
    int res = 0, f = 1;
    char c = getchar();
    while (c < '0' || c > '9') {
        if (c == '-')
            f = -1;
        c = getchar();
    }
    while (c >= '0' && c <= '9') {
        res = res * 10 + c - 48;
        c = getchar();
    }
    return res * f;
}

signed main() {
    n = rd;
    int cnt = 0;
    for (int i = 1; i < n; ++i) {
        for (int j = i + 1; j <= n; ++j) {
            if (__gcd(i, j) == (i ^ j))
                cnt++;
        }
    }
    printf("%lld\n", cnt);
    return 0;
}
子任务 #1
Time Limit Exceeded
得分:30
测试点 #1
Accepted
得分:100
用时:4 ms
内存:400 KiB

输入文件(gcd0.in

268

答案文件(gcd0.out

385

用户输出

385

系统信息

Exited with return code 0
测试点 #2
Accepted
得分:100
用时:4 ms
内存:276 KiB

输入文件(gcd1.in

297

答案文件(gcd1.out

426

用户输出

426

系统信息

Exited with return code 0
测试点 #3
Accepted
得分:100
用时:6 ms
内存:264 KiB

输入文件(gcd2.in

327

答案文件(gcd2.out

470

用户输出

470

系统信息

Exited with return code 0
测试点 #4
Time Limit Exceeded
得分:0
用时:1039 ms
内存:308 KiB

输入文件(gcd3.in

99201

答案文件(gcd3.out

172054
测试点 #5
Time Limit Exceeded
得分:0
用时:1023 ms
内存:384 KiB

输入文件(gcd4.in

74945

答案文件(gcd4.out

129824
测试点 #6
Time Limit Exceeded
得分:0
用时:1042 ms
内存:232 KiB

输入文件(gcd5.in

96723

答案文件(gcd5.out

167627
测试点 #7
Time Limit Exceeded
得分:0
用时:1015 ms
内存:240 KiB

输入文件(gcd6.in

5000000

答案文件(gcd6.out

8723182
测试点 #8
Time Limit Exceeded
得分:0
用时:1014 ms
内存:240 KiB

输入文件(gcd7.in

6000000

答案文件(gcd7.out

10467026
测试点 #9
Time Limit Exceeded
得分:0
用时:1052 ms
内存:276 KiB

输入文件(gcd8.in

8000000

答案文件(gcd8.out

13956088
测试点 #10
Time Limit Exceeded
得分:0
用时:1017 ms
内存:276 KiB

输入文件(gcd9.in

10000000

答案文件(gcd9.out

17440305